Customers are saying
Customers regard the HP Envy x360 2-in-1 15.6" Touch-Screen Laptop favorably, particularly praising its touchscreen, performance, ease of use, and lightweight design. Many appreciate the ample RAM and find the price reasonable. However, some customers noted issues with fan noise and the hard drive, while others wished for more USB ports.

Froze every 30-45 mins
||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.Unfortunately I had to return this laptop after about two weeks. No matter what I was doing it would completely lock up and not respond. I would hard reset the computer only to repeat the process after another 30-45 minutes of use. Turns out (according to the HP Support Forums) that this is a very common issue. I'm honestly surprised they haven't recalled them all.
